When renting a furnished apartment to protect your investment, it is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the things contained in the apartment rental. Be very specific; list the number of plates, bowls, and cups, for instance, and describe items as correctly as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if it is damaged beyond normal wear and tear, or if the piece is taken by the renter with him when he moves out. Signal if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it, or if the renter will must pay you directly for the items. Have the tenant sign a copy of this stock so there aren't any surprises when the rental comes to a finish.

If you rent a home or apartment that's furnished, whether it's f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ronics, and accessories or contains only some basic furniture, you can bill tenants higher rent. You'd to buy the things which are furnishing the house, and will have to replace those things if they can be damaged or destroyed. Those costs will be recouped by a monthly rent that is higher. It really is up to you as the landlord to decide how much more you desire to charge for the furnishings, but usually owners will base the increased cost on the condition and style of the furnishings. For example, a property that includes a brand new, modern living room set is worth more than one that contains pieces that are mismatched with frayed seams.
In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could ask for a higher security deposit on the rental. Collecting more cash up front can assist you to cover the costs of replacing or repairing the things in the furnished apartment if they may be damaged. Before collecting the security deposit, though check with your state laws. Some states have laws controlling what landlords can charge and security deposits. If you do not wish to contain it in the security deposit, you could also charge another cleaning fee for the rental, to pay for the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, curtains and other things.

Any service that incurs a fee should be contained in the lease, including phone use,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Sometimes, elective services are available, like daily housekeeping services in addition to cleaning upon departure. These should be, at the absolute minimum, listed on the lease in case the vacationers choose to use the service after they arrive. Anticipations about the use of the property should also be clearly indicated in the lease or via a procedures guide refer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es the garbage out and where does it go? Should the sheets be stripped by the vacationers or by housekeeping?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? All of these are issues which should be addressed avert struggles over the stay and the lease and to ensure a smooth holiday.
